The Bombay High Court has directed the high court's registry in Mumbai to convert an existing washroom into a restroom designed for individuals who use wheelchairs and those with orthopaedic disabilities. 

The division bench, consisting of Justice Sunil B Shukre and Justice Firdosh Pooniwalla, has directed the registry to submit the proposal for this conversion to the appropriate committee for consideration.

"We would, therefore, request the registry to consider this difficulty, prepare an appropriate proposal for either conversion of one of the washrooms in High Court building at Mumbai into a washroom to be used for the wheel chaired, orthopedic disabled persons and place it before the appropriate committee for its due consideration as early as possible. Registrar (Original Side) is requested to do the needful," the court ordered.

The bench was hearing a plea filed in 2021 that sought infrastructure facilities to be made available for orthopedically disabled persons in the entire state of Maharashtra.

The additional government pleader stated that they needed to gather information from across the entire state of Maharashtra to make informed decisions on this matter. As a result, he sought additional time from the high court for this purpose.

Considering that no relief was granted to disabled persons since 2021, the division bench directed the government to complete the exercise within 8 weeks. 

"Considering the fact that this matter is pending since the year 2021 and so far nothing has moved towards providing of some relief and respite to physical challenged persons working in the State Government/Corporation and visiting the offices of the State Government and Corporation, it is necessary now that some time limit is prescribed by this court for the authorities to complete the entire exercises " the court said. 

The petitioner's counsel highlighted that disabled individuals face a lack of accessible washrooms when visiting government offices, including the high court building.

In response, the court directed the registry to explore the possibility of converting an existing washroom into one that is accessible for disabled persons within the high court building. 

The matter has now been scheduled for further directions on December 7, 2023.

Case title: Maharashtra Rajya Apang Karmachari Sanstha vs State of Maharashtra & Ors
